Olivia Rodrigo Stuns in Plunging Halter Dress at 2025 Grammys with Louis Partridge

Olivia Rodrigo Grammys 2025 night wasn’t about wins but about her undeniable presence and industry dominance.

Olivia Rodrigo turned heads at the 2025 Grammy Awards in a sultry vintage Versace halter dress. The gown featured daring cutouts at the chest and hips, giving her a bold and glamorous look. Rodrigo, who is presenting at the ceremony, arrived with her boyfriend, Louis Partridge. Though they didn’t pose together on the red carpet, the couple was spotted inside the event.

This year, Rodrigo has just one Grammy nomination for Best Song Written for Visual Media with “Can’t Catch Me Now.” The song was featured in The Hunger Games: The Ballad of Songbirds & Snakes. While she doesn’t have major nominations this year, Olivia Rodrigo at the Grammys remains a highly anticipated presence. Her past successes and performances have cemented her as a fan favorite at music’s biggest night.

Rodrigo spent most of 2024 on tour following the release of GUTS in 2023. The album was recognized at last year’s Grammys, solidifying her status as one of pop’s biggest stars. Olivia Rodrigo Grammys 2025 fans were excited to see her grace the red carpet again, proving her lasting influence in the industry. The singer is set to continue performing in 2025, with scheduled appearances at Lollapalooza Chile, Argentina, and Brazil this March.

In a November interview with Vogue, Rodrigo shared how she stays grounded during her demanding tour schedule. “I do all the classic things,” she said. “Call my therapist, go to the gym, I eat really healthy, and I don’t drink.” She also revealed that creativity is a crucial part of her self-care routine. “Journaling is always the antidote,” she explained.

Though Rodrigo isn’t up for major awards, her friend and tour opener Chappell Roan is having a breakthrough year. Roan has six nominations, including Record of the Year, Album of the Year, and Best New Artist.
